SCARBOROUGH — School Board member Jane Wiseman on Friday withdrew from the Nov. 6 ballot, leaving the election uncontested.

Wiseman, who is chairwoman of the board’s Policy Committee, turned in nomination papers to seek a third term Wednesday.

On Friday she said a new business venture and a need for more family time are the reasons for her decision to withdraw.

Scarborough Town Clerk Yolande Justice said Wiseman on Friday asked that her name be removed from the ballot.

“I have truly enjoyed serving on the board and will continue to support the educational values in Scarborough,” Wiseman said in an email Friday.

Her decision leaves the election for three School Board seats, each for a term of three years, to Donna Beeley, Christopher Caiazzo and incumbent Jacquelyn Perry.
